There seems to be a bug in the Hotlist plugin, if anyone can confirm?

In Hotlist>Edit, when right-clicking on "All bookmarks" (=on top), one can create new folders and new bookmarks, but afterwards they vanish in Nirwana . If there were existing bookmarks moved into the new folder, they are deleted.

The same actions work fine if starting the right-click anywhere else further down.

I know the Hotlist is quite outdated and not exactly on top of the priority list :cool: but if links are vanishing that's critical IMO. Perhaps a minimal fix would be to simply gray out the "new" entries if the mouse is over "All bookmarks"?

Interesting... I think you found a cue why things get deleted that way!
If the mouse hovers over a folder while creating anything, the new stuff is not created inside but instead side by side to the hovered folder! And of course the same level as "all bookmarks" cannot be, so it vanishes....

Same for creating a subfolder, it works okay if the mouse is hovering inside while creating, alternatively the folders can also be dragged inside afterwards.

PS: The "Netscape Bookmarks" have this correct, they create already inside, not next to hovered folders :cool:
